In Los Angeles, the police foundation helped to finance the purchase of surveillance software from big data firm Palantir. The Philadelphia Police Foundation took down information from its website as multiple universities that were listed as partners have faced protests from activists calling on them to cease their support for the group. According to themost recent saved version of the pagefrom May 3, New York City Police Foundations board is chaired by Andrew Tisch, the co-chair of Loews Corporation. The NYC Police Foundation reported that it raised $5.5 million from its annual benefit in 2019. The New York City Police Foundation today announced the first 22 winners in its $1 million grant program to create innovative new projects at NYPD precincts. Known as 50 Grants for 50 Precincts, the competition launched in January 2021, and to date has received 175 submissions for ideas that serve the needs of the police precinct and its surrounding community. Among the winning innovations are those to promote engagement between police officers and kids, officer wellness, strengthen community engagement, honor fallen officers, and more. Proposals for the 50 Grants for 50 Precincts program are evaluated by a committee consisting of representatives from the NYPD, Police Foundation Staff and Board of Trustees, to determine the grant winners. The foundation, a public-private "charity," was started in 1971 by the Association for a Better New York, a consortium of business interests linked to a turn towards the privatization of New York City in the 1970s and which is still influential today.
